阿里云云RDSMySQL数据库1核2核的区别?

结论:阿里云RDS MySQL数据库1核与2核的主要区别体现在计算性能、并发处理能力以及适用场景上。对于小型应用或测试环境,1核版本通常已足够;而对于中等以上业务负载或需要更高响应速度的系统,建议选择2核版本。

在使用阿里云RDS(Relational Database Service)MySQL服务时,用户常常会面临选择不同配置实例的问题,其中“1核”和“2核”的CPU配置是最常见的两种入门级选项。虽然它们看起来只是CPU数量的不同,但实际上对数据库性能和稳定性有着显著影响。


一、核心数的基本含义

  • 1核:表示该实例拥有一个虚拟CPU核心,适用于轻量级任务。
  • 2核:表示该实例拥有两个虚拟CPU核心,具备更强的并行计算能力。

在数据库领域,CPU是决定查询执行速度、事务处理效率的重要因素之一。核心数越多,意味着数据库可以同时处理更多的请求和操作。


二、性能差异对比

  • 单线程性能接近:在单个线程任务中,1核与2核的性能差异不大,主要取决于主频配置。
  • 并发处理能力显著不同
    • 1核实例在面对多个并发连接或复杂查询时容易出现资源瓶颈。
    • 2核实例能更好地应对并发压力,支持更高的QPS(每秒查询率)和TPS(每秒事务数)。

因此,在高并发或数据密集型场景下,2核版本更具优势。


三、适用场景分析

实例类型 推荐场景
1核 测试环境、小型网站、低频访问的应用
2核 中小型业务系统、电商平台、日志分析系统

例如,如果你运营的是一个刚起步的博客网站,1核RDS可能已经绰绰有余;但如果你部署的是一个订单交易系统,那么2核将提供更稳定的性能保障,避免因数据库瓶颈导致的服务延迟或失败。


四、成本考量

  • 1核实例价格更低,适合预算有限的用户。
  • 2核实例价格稍高,但带来的性能提升往往值得投资。

从长期来看,如果业务有增长预期,直接选择2核实例更能避免频繁升级带来的迁移成本和时间损耗。


五、其他相关因素

  • 内存配置:通常1核对应较小内存,2核则搭配更大内存,进一步增强性能。
  • I/O吞吐能力:部分2核实例也支持更高的磁盘IO性能,提升整体响应速度。
  • 可扩展性:2核实例通常支持更高的自动扩容上限,适应未来业务发展。

总结

阿里云RDS MySQL数据库1核与2核的核心区别在于并发处理能力和系统稳定性。 对于小型项目或测试用途,1核版本足够使用;但对于有一定访问量或需长期运行的生产环境,推荐优先考虑2核版本。选择合适的配置不仅有助于提升系统性能,也能为未来的业务扩展打下良好基础。

未经允许不得转载:云知道CLOUD » 阿里云云RDSMySQL数据库1核2核的区别?